An articular surface tear will be seen as cortical bone irregularity on the greater tuberosity. This may extend proximally along the rim of the bone causing what is known as a de-laminating tear. WebDec 7, 2024 · Chondrolabral separation refers to a form of chondrolabral injury, where the acetabular labrum is separated from the adjacent cartilage at the articular margin. Terminology Chondrolabral separation is referred to as a chondrolabral injury seen in the hip. It can also occur in the shoulder joint, but similar injuries there are termed differently.
